Dr. Zhongchi Liu is a research fellow at Centre for Marine Technology and Ocean Engineering at Instituto Superior Tecnico, University of Lisbon. His research focuses on analysis and design of offshore aquaculture systems, measurement and monitoring for floating systems and intelligent aquaculture farms. Dr. Liu has published his research in leading international journals in the fields of maritime engineering and aquaculture structure. His expertise is well-recognized in the field of marine technology and offshore engineering. His research interests primarily include the optimization and sustainable development of offshore aquaculture systems, long-term monitoring and fault diagnosis of offshore platforms and application of artificial intelligence in offshore structures.
